The p1 dna in the phage head is a linear doublestranded molecule and must be circularized when it enters the host. Mar 11, 2004 p1 genes expressed in the lytic pathway are those involved in the timing of phage development, in replication from a lytic origin different from orir, in the formation of phage particles, including headful packaging, and finally in cell lysis to release the phage progeny.
